  • Abstract
    One of the problems encountered in wireless sensor networks is the effect of noisy links. So, in this paper we propose a new adaptive estimation algorithm that mitigates the effect of noisy links in diffusion least mean square (DLMS) adaptive networks. Our proposed algorithm is based on combining the cooperative and non-cooperative schemes, but this combination is done in a regular manner. Using this idea, we can benefit the cooperation advantage, and at the same time mitigate the effect of noisy links. Simulation results show that our proposed algorithm overrides the performance of the other algorithms proposed for this purpose.
